Quarterly Planning Note — Retail Pilot

For the board: the pilot with the Hartleby retail chain begins in eight stores across the Fennmarsh region next quarter. Stock integration testing with our Orvale platform completed cleanly, and staffing is confirmed. Costs remain within the envelope approved in March. Dreyton will report monthly. The confidential expansion note follows directly below.

management briefing: Eliaxax Works is in early talks to buy Casoxox Systems for about $61.5 million. The Framir launch date is May 17, and nothing goes to the press before then.

## Changelog — Tracewisp 1.9

### Changed defaults

Tracewisp now samples at a lower default rate across all microservices and propagates context headers by default, removing the per-service opt-in. Span retention was shortened to reduce storage pressure. Services pinned to older collectors are unaffected until redeployed. Release builds after this version ship with the defaults listed below.

service settings:
[casax]
port = 6379
team = rusir
host = casax.zemvarhq.corp
region = outer-4
access_code = ac_9808ce
timeout_ms = 1500

### Onboarding: StockTally Reconciliation Job

Welcome to the team. The StockTally job reconciles warehouse counts against ledger entries nightly at 02:00, and any variance above threshold opens a review task automatically. Please read the variance guide before your first on-call shift. If the job's credential store becomes sealed after a failed rotation, it must be reopened using the recovery passphrase provided immediately below.

vault phrase of hahop-badug = novvan-ulaion-zorius-noviel-gorwyn-casix-tamys

- [ ] Verify the Crashfern pipeline ingested symbolicated reports from the Petalwing 4.2 release candidate before promoting to the Ostrova store track. Check that retention pruning did not drop the beta cohort, and confirm dSYM coverage is above threshold. Record sign-off in the on-call log alongside the release token that appears below.

session token of tajef-bageg = htk21_5d90d574934f3ccae6437